Sizing for Indian Riders
Tifosi designs the Smirk as a one-size-fits-most adult frame. Indian riders with narrower or smaller faces should check frame width before ordering. Adjustable nose pads and temple tips allow meaningful customisation — useful when riding with a helmet in humid conditions around Coorg or Ooty where a secure, sweat-stable fit is critical. Prescription insert compatibility varies; verify with Cobbled Climbs before purchase.

How does the Tifosi Smirk compare to polarised sport sunglasses?
Unlike polarised sunglasses, the Smirk's non-polarised lens does not reduce glare on reflective water surfaces but offers a key advantage: full readability of LCD cycling computers, GPS units, and power meter displays at all angles. For riders who rely on data during training in Pune or racing in Hyderabad, non-polarised lenses are often the more practical choice.
